[12] For example, when an accommodation has two through four units, "[t]he tenants may respond to an owner's offer first jointly, then severally," and "a group of tenants acting jointly shall have 15 days to provide the owner and the Mayor with a written statement of interest." D.C.Code § 42-3404.10(1) (2001). "Following that time period, if the tenants acting jointly have failed to submit a written statement of interest, an individual tenant shall have 7 days to provide a statement of interest to the owner and the Mayor." Id.
